First Step Family Support Center

Drop-In Coordinator/ Community Health Worker Part-Time, estimated 19 hours a week; $16 per hour

DESCRIPTION: The Drop-In Coordinator will staff our Drop-In Center which provides a safe place for families to receive resources including information and referrals. This position will be part of the MSS (Maternity Support Services) team functioning as a Community Health Worker actively supporting women to encourage a healthy pregnancy, healthy birth, and provide advocacy and information services for pregnant women and parents with babies under one year of age.
